Why Visit Genthin? #

Located amid waterways in Saxony-Anhalt, Genthin appeals to visitors who enjoy quiet historic towns and outdoor recreation along the Elbe-Havel canal. Brick Gothic churches and a compact market square reflect regional architectural styles, and cycling or boating routes make the surrounding lakes and wetlands easy to explore. It serves as a low-key base for visiting Magdeburg and the rural landscapes of northeastern Germany.

Best Time to Visit Genthin #

Visit Genthin between late spring and early autumn for warm, pleasant weather and outdoor activities along rivers and trails. Winters are cool and quiet with occasional snow, better for indoor visits.

Winter
December - February · -5°C to 5°C (23°F to 41°F)
Chilly, grey winters with occasional snow; museums and cafés are cozy, but outdoor sightseeing feels brisk and quiet.
Summer
June - August · 16°C to 28°C (61°F to 82°F)
Warm, pleasant summers are perfect for cycling, river strolls and beer gardens - expect sunny days and lively local life.
Spring/Autumn
March - May & September - November · 5°C to 18°C (41°F to 64°F)
Mild shoulder seasons deliver comfortable temperatures and blooming or turning foliage; great for relaxed exploring and fewer tourists.

How to Get to Genthin

Genthin in Saxony-Anhalt is well served by regional rail on the Berlin-Magdeburg corridor, and nearby international airports (BER, LEJ) provide the main air connections. Trains are usually the most convenient way to arrive and to reach nearby cities.

By Air

Berlin Brandenburg Airport (BER): BER is the nearest major international airport with the most flight options to and from Germany. From BER, Genthin is reachable by regional train via Berlin or Brandenburg an der Havel-total rail journey is typically 1.5-2.5 hours; expect regional fares in the €15-€30 range depending on ticket type.

Leipzig/Halle Airport (LEJ): LEJ is another option with regional connections; travel to Genthin by rail usually involves regional services and transfers and takes around 1.5-2.5 hours. Fares are similar to those from Berlin when using regional trains.

By Train & Bus

Train: Genthin has its own railway station (Genthin) on the Berlin-Magdeburg line with regional Deutsche Bahn (DB) services. Regional trains connect Genthin to Magdeburg, Brandenburg and Berlin; journey times to Magdeburg are typically 20-30 minutes and to Berlin 45-70 minutes depending on service. Regional fares vary (S-Bahn/RE/Regional Express tickets or Länder tickets are common).

Bus: Local buses cover routes within the district and connect smaller villages to Genthin town centre and station. Buses are suitable for last-mile travel where trains don’t run.

How to Get Around Genthin #

Genthin’s centre is compact and walkable; many local errands can be done on foot. The town is served by regional trains and buses that connect to Magdeburg and surrounding towns, and bicycles are a common way to get around locally. Taxis are available but not abundant. Regional rail and bus fares are modest; if you plan day trips, check Deutsche Bahn/MDV regional tickets for best value. Allow extra time for connections outside peak hours.

Where to Stay in Genthin #

Budget
Genthin / Magdeburg - €35-80/night
Genthin itself has few low-cost beds; budget travelers often stay in nearby Magdeburg for more choices and lower prices.
Mid-Range
Magdeburg (near Genthin) - €80-140/night
Mid-range options are limited in Genthin; most visitors choose Magdeburg (~30-40 minutes) for comfortable hotels and more dining choices.
Luxury
Magdeburg - €140+/night
There are no true luxury hotels in Genthin; upper-tier stays are in Magdeburg where full-service hotels are available.

Nightlife in Genthin #

Nightlife in Genthin is low-key, focused on local pubs, beer gardens and occasional cultural events at community venues. You won’t find a large club scene; weekends are when bars are busiest. If you want a livelier night out, plan to travel to larger nearby cities.

Shopping in Genthin #

Shopping in Genthin is practical rather than tourist-oriented: supermarkets, local shops and small specialist retailers serve residents. There’s usually a weekly market (Wochenmarkt) where local produce and basics are sold. For a wider retail selection and big-brand stores, Magdeburg is the nearest option.
